How can I link my vanilla one debit card to a digital wallet for cryptocurrencies?
I have a vanilla one debit card and I want to link it to a digital wallet so that I can store and use cryptocurrencies. How can I do that?

- Shiyu LuJun 17, 2020 · 6 years agoSure, linking your vanilla one debit card to a digital wallet for cryptocurrencies is possible. You can start by choosing a digital wallet that supports debit card integration. Once you have selected a suitable wallet, you will need to follow the wallet's instructions for adding a debit card. This usually involves providing your card details and verifying your ownership. After successfully linking your debit card, you can then use it to buy, sell, and store cryptocurrencies within the digital wallet.
- uday_bushettiwarApr 22, 2025 · a year agoAbsolutely! To link your vanilla one debit card to a digital wallet for cryptocurrencies, you'll need to find a wallet that supports debit card integration. Look for popular wallets like Coinbase, Binance, or BitPay, as they often offer this feature. Once you've chosen a wallet, follow the instructions provided by the wallet provider to add your debit card. This typically involves entering your card details and verifying your identity. Once your card is linked, you'll be able to use it to manage your cryptocurrencies within the wallet.
